实时信息交互技术

源标题:微信也爱用的实时交互

作者:stella

公号:SS工作室

实时技术把刚刚发生的信息传递给用户,于是有了whatsapp,有了米聊,火了微信。但是它是如何提高产品的用户体验,并满足用户期待的呢?

几年前,像低延时,网页接口和实时功能等词汇是开发的前沿。现在这项技术已经成为我们常用的app的主要成分:facebook的消息提醒;Uber的实时位置跟踪;Google Docs的多用户协同工作等。所以你是不是也应该把这项技术用到你的产品中呢?

发现重要的产品特色

一个有了更好,没有也可以的的前沿功能/技术现在作为产品的特色,将来可能就是这个产品或者所有同类产品必须有的一个元素。

拿触屏技术举例:2007年,Apple发布了iPhone,是智能手机市场的一场革命。然后很快用手指滑动屏幕,缩放图片成为了一种规范和标准。Alfred Poor在计算机世界中这样描述触屏技术:

现在我们不仅把触屏当做理所当然,我们也希望应用多点触控和手势。

我们再也不会把触屏当做一个很有吸引力的特色,它已经变成智能手机用户体验的一个核心部分。

那么,实时技术是产品的一个吸引点还是必须有的功能呢?一个管理学技术-卡诺模型帮助我们更好的理解这一点。试想实时技术和卡诺模型的四个类型不难发现实时技术正在从一个“吸引人的特色”向一个“必须有的功能”过渡。

表现:“它们是客户喜欢有而不喜欢没有的。”

必须:“客户从忍受它到期待它。”

吸引力:“我们建议的是既新颖又有吸引人的。”

中性的:“这些发生在任何‘我是中性的’或‘我能容忍它’的答案中。”

1464756606-1926-XHFuWficCiaicfQtG7d9VdBXPTbQ
卡诺模型的四个类型

下面探讨一下实时技术的起源以及它是如何在一些流行的应用中被用户当做一个必须有的品质的。

最早使用实时技术的产品

如果我们回顾实时技术的历史,就不难理解它为什么会成为现在很多产品和工具的核心功能。一个最早的实时技术应用例子就是股票市场。允许交易员低延迟地执行自己的交易,使金融领域发生了革命性变化。Richard Mart的文章《华尔街追求以光速来处理数据》中写道:

在交易程序中的1毫秒的优势可以值一个一年一亿美元的大型经济公司。

现在,在美国股市,高频交易代表了超过半数的交易。

实时技术的无缝集成

实时技术已经融入了很多我们常用的应用中,我们几乎已经忽略了它的存在而把它当做一个理所当然的事情。如果有人给你在微信上发了消息,你希望马上看到它。

另一个好的例子是Google Docs,它在2007年发布,到2014年10月份已经拥有大约2.4亿活跃用户。

书写,编辑和协作如果没有实时技术也可以实现基本功能。但是,实时技术可以让多个用户一起合作编辑,而不会产生冲突和延迟,这是它成功的关键。现在重新看卡诺模型,这也支持了我们所说的实时技术正在从一个有吸引力的特色向一个必须有的核心功能转变。

但是实时技术也不仅限于聊天和协同工作的应用中,它在运动应用中被用来跟踪分数,例如Fitbit中可以实时记录你的健康情况。然而这也只是个开始。

公司是如何让用户融入实时技术的

应用内部提醒在app中很流行,比如微博,推特等。如果有我们感兴趣的消息或者有人给我们发了一个信息,我们希望能够立即收到。让用户等待已经成为历史。Facebook用了实时的应用内部提醒来把用户的吸引力放到新的故事,消息,加好友请求和更多与用户相关的事情上。

1464756609-4238-hKhicMEUAKsCdtOcP7jPEcnkanBA
Facebook的应用内部提醒

理解这个交互元素很重要。研究表明100ms的反应对人类来说是即时的,250ms是平均反应时间。Twitter的动态消息是一个很好的例子,每秒钟有上百万条推文更新,如果界面上实时更新的话,用户会很费解。所以,Twitter控制了动态消息更新的频率,给用户一些推送,让信息更加好理解。

用实时数据领先你的对手

Deliveroo公司最近正在动摇食物快递行业,拥有300个快递驾驶员和自行车手,超过50,000用户,更不用说它在各个英国和国际上的扩张。

它成功的关键是什么呢?Deliveroo定位自己是一家把高质量的本地餐厅的食物送到你家的公司。Deliveroo给他们的客户提供了一个非常高质量的服务体验。其中一个特色是他们实时跟踪食物订单信息功能。用户可以跟踪他们的快递过程,所有的过程包括食物的准备到运送都可以实时看到。

1464756609-2974-4AnFXluyZG2hwSWISIAEh5BuYeVw
Deliveroo的实时跟踪系统

这是一个用实时技术给用户提供高质量服务,从而加强用户体验的很好的例子。与之形成鲜明对比的是Domino,一个类似的应用。但是它没有实时的功能,而是要求用户手动刷新,这样用户非常地苦恼。

1464756609-2508-SvB5D6Oju0ibOQIGdtmHvhRujT1Q
Domino的订单个弄脏系统
 

有像Deliveroo和Uber这样的公司引领实时地理位置跟踪体验的公司,实时技术在各个行业普及也只是时间的问题而已。

实时技术是我们生活的一部分

实时技术已经融入我们每天的生活中,从通过app查看地铁公交的出发时间,到用Apple Watch记录我们每天的运动量。

自然而然地,随着物联网和传统应用的发展,这个技术开始融入我们生活的更多领域。以Nest(一个智能家居领域的领先者)作为例子,这家公司正在把家具变得更加智能化,它的产品用一个实时的接口去创造人和机器之间即时的交互,并且不用和机器有实际接触。这意味无论你在哪里,你可以时刻控制你的家。Nest已经在2014年被Google以大约32亿美元的价格收购。

1464756606-4379-MoLQDTkb7sDd7bbhbItncu7HQeQQ
Nest的自动调温器

Nest的自动调温器可以让你通过一个App控制室内的问题。类似的产品,能够得到实时的提醒是这个服务的关键要素。

在使用实时技术的时候需要注意什么?

在使用实时技术的时候,有两件事情要特别注意:如何设计才能达到最好的效果?可能产生的负面效应有哪些?

如果你的app失去连接会发生什么,或者系统自动更新了但是没有提示你?这时给用户反馈和提醒是非常重要的。如果你的实时应用出现了连接问题,如果不及时通知用户,那体验就会大打折扣。

就像所有的最新技术一样,考虑这个技术是否适用于你的产品非常重要。虽然实时技术带来很多好处,但是我们也需要对它可能产生的负面效应加以关注。发给用户一个实时的提醒会不会也是一种干扰呢?

这些数据会不会成为一种干扰取决于你的用法。例如在动态消息中发送一张大图片,或者发送提醒到用户手机。如果你发送大量的数据,那么实时技术可能就是最佳的方式。一些合理的解决方案有:等待用户发送下载命令的时候在下载额外的数据,或者测试用户的设备是否有wifi(而不是移动网络)再发送。

让实时技术为你服务

上面的例子清楚地解释了怎样用实时技术来加强产品的用户体验。但是不仅仅止步于此,还有更多创新的方式来应用实时技术。

把它看得像一个管理工具一样平常。添加实时功能可以让用户在项目中合作,可以让他们的各个设备和平台都保持同步,从根本上提高工作效率。

实时功能在预订和电商网站上也很常见。那些实时的提醒可以显示有多少用户正在看这个商品,告诉用户这个商品的剩余库存,鼓励他们在售完之前购买。

包装实时技术

Whatsapp(实时聊天工具),Google Docs,Facebook,Twitter和Nest的成功有赖于实时技术,而他们也只是冰山一角。还有一大批公司正在应用实时技术。

像Deliveroo和Uber这样的公司提供给我们即时的服务,并且能够实时跟踪。如果你的App没有提供这样的服务,那么他们已经过时了。

你能通过实时技术的一些特色,例如应用内部提醒,地理位置跟踪,协同工作和数据可视化来提高产品的用户体验吗?实时功能可以提高用户满意度,并且让你领先于对手。

实时技术正在快速融入我们的日常生活,记住:今天的新颖特色也许就是明天的必备功能。

推荐此文是为了传递更多交互方面的知识内容,转载请联系原作者:原文链接

原创文章,作者:ioued,如若转载,请注明出处:https://www.iamue.com/15252/

(0)
iouedioued
上一篇 2016-05-31
下一篇 2016-06-01

相关推荐

  • 译文|交互设计初学者的完全指南

    交互设计起源于网站设计和图形设计,但现在已经成长为一个独立的领域。现在的交互设计师远非仅仅负责文字和图片,而是负责创建在屏幕上的所有元素,所有用户可能会触摸,点按或者输入的东西:简而言之,产品体验中的所有交互。

    2017-05-27
  • 在一个老外微信PM的眼中,中国App UI那些事

    中美用户习惯的和文化的不同,造成了设计很多的不同。看惯了国内的设计,你了解外国人怎么看待我们的产品吗?接下来就可以带着疑问往下阅读。 本文编译自Dan Grover的博客,他现在是腾讯微信的产品经理。以下是他从…

    交互设计 2014-12-11
  • 一个APP的视觉风格:配图是一个重要的,同时极易被忽略的点

    在我们常规意义上组成一个APP的视觉风格有几大元素——颜色、交互元素、字体、阴影、ICON的图形等,但是有一个总容易被设计师们忽略的元素,它能给与用户一个非常直观的视觉记忆,大家却总是忽略,甚至做的很糟糕。那就是APP里面的配图。

    2017-05-12
  • 如何运用“交互式电子白板”,凸显英语课堂教学的“交互性”?

    今天小编带大家认识什么是交互式电子白板?以及它在教学中的应用。让我们一起来了解一下吧。 交互式电子白板整合了普通黑板这和现代多媒体教学的优势。随着社会科技的发展,多媒体技术早已进入了课堂,但传统教学中…

    2015-04-15
  • 1.6万字诚意之作|如果你想成为一名交互设计师,这篇文章值得慢读

    关于交互设计,这是一篇很全很全很全(重要事情要说三遍)的科普文章。作者写了1.6万字,实在是诚意之作。如果你打算走进交互,此文值得真的真的真的(重要事情要说三遍)值得一读^_^ by 小编目录导读:
    1. 交互设计概念
    2. 交互设计输出物
    3. 交互设计相关理论
    4. 交互设计流程及方法
    5. 交互设计常见案例分析
    6. 交互设计规范及趋势
    7. 交互设计师进阶之路举个例子就是:小明饿了,他需要填饱肚子(目标),他跑到楼下的餐馆进行点餐、吃饭、结账(任务),吃完了出门的时候推门(行为)出去,然后过马路回家。交互指的是产品与它的使用者之间的互动过程,而交互设计师则是秉承以用户为中心的设计理念,以用户体验度为原则,对交互过程进行研究并开展设计的工作人员。——百度百科①初级交互设计师<10k:俗称「线框仔」,出没于小公司和外包公司,没有设计决策权,专门配给不会画图的产品经理使用。门槛低,只需要熟练使用原型软件,会看着其它APP抄设计即可。无发展前途,看到此类岗位请远离。
    ②中级交互设计师10k-15k:除了画线框图外参与一定的产品层面的工作,有一定设计决策权,通常为知名院校应届毕业生,可以对设计决策提出异议,但不一定被接受。
    ③高级交互设计师15k-25k:通常可以参与整个产品的概念过程,工作职能与产品经理更为接近,有更多的设计决策权,通常工作经验超过2年,可以和产品经理、视觉设计师、用户研究员及开发人员进行「激烈讨论」,并有能力维护设计师的尊严。
    ④资深交互设计师>25k:通常出没于BAT、财大气粗的创业公司及设计咨询公司。有着丰富的成功设计案例,通常工作经验超过5年,有主流大公司工作经验,有大型项目的设计管理经验,业内有一定名气。
    ——以上分级,参考寺主人在知乎的回答《如何成为交互设计师?》“你在设计的生涯中,有没有用到或者总结出哪些设计方法?”“以规则的网格阵列来指导和规范网页中的版面布局以及信息分布。对于网页设计来说,栅格系统的使用,不仅可以让网页的信息呈现更加美观易读,更具可用性。而且,对于前端开发来说,网页将更加的灵活与规范。”“关于弹窗中的“推荐选项”应该放在左边还是右边,分了两种情况:如果推荐选项有破坏性,那么应该放在左边。如果没有破坏性,则应该放在右边。但到了iOS10的时候,却变成了推荐选项都应该放在右边。”

    2017-05-06
  • 交互设计的两个核心问题:用户体验和以用户目标为导向

    设计师和用户如同在跳交际舞,既要顺应着对方的步伐,也要进行一定的引导。对方是一个人,不只是你感受的到他的温度,他也闻得到你身上的味道,对你时时刻刻进行着评价。

    2017-05-21
  • 交互设计相关岗位-用户研究(实习)——杭州海康威视

    杭州海康威视招聘 用户研究(实习)    职位要求: 1、人机交互、认知心理学、计算机、设计艺术或相关专业研究生在读。 2、熟悉研究方法论,熟悉一般研究步骤,了解各种研究方法,有坚实的统计和数据分析基础 3、较…

    交互设计招聘 2018-03-13
  • Reading Your User | 设计心理学书籍推荐

    研究大众的心理学对于设计是很有帮助的。用户在围绕着你的产品所进行的一系列行为举止背后的动机是什么,与之互动时进行过哪些心理活动,外部的哪些因素能够成功影响用户的决策……这些都能够设计师完成更好的设计。

    2017-05-20
  • 【用户体验.春节特辑】理清儿时的记忆 找回逝去的情感(总第270期)

    亦可访问www.koushutianxia.com了解详情编家谱   修家史   留视频建祠堂   亲互动   传万代总第270期生活在这样一个时代,人们追求物质、追求理想、追求个性……而不去回望来路,不去寻求亲情和血缘所带来的归属感。“游子的情怀”和“漂泊的现境”总是让我们不由自主的追问自己:是否我们必须要失去我们最宝贵的东西才能实现自己的人生目标,我们实现自己的人生目标到底又是为了什么?我出生在安徽的一个小城里,由于父母工作繁忙,我...

    2018-02-21
  • Axure RP 8 入门手册 – 第1章(下)

    第2节原型相关的文件类型芝芝:小楼老师,我不小心把软件关闭了,我编辑的文件在哪?小楼:你新建完文件没有保存吗?芝芝:我有生成HTML文件,但是好像不能用软件打开呀?小楼:看在颜值的份上,我给你讲讲吧!与Axure相关的文件有几种类型:分别是“.rp”文件、“.rplib”文件、“.rpprj”文件以及“HTML”文件。“.rp”文件:独立原型项目的源文件,这是最重要的文件,只有这个文件才能进行原型的编辑与输出。“.rpprj”文件:团队...

    2018-03-31